Output ed35e11bcfe54b80538cee0438cf02235c242f2fad30803a30fb93bd49f6e5ef:96

value
176669
script pubkey
OP_0 OP_PUSHBYTES_20 0afb9f9b188768156e7601ad18cac1b3a00807ef
address
bc1qptaelxccsa5p2mnkqxk33jkpkwsqspl0xxq84c
transaction
ed35e11bcfe54b80538cee0438cf02235c242f2fad30803a30fb93bd49f6e5ef
confirmations
904
spent
true